STEP 4: Build mortar bed and install tile to create a 1-2% grade towards drain.
STEP 5: Install tile into tile insert tray. (Tile Insert Drains only)
STEP 6: Remove 2x4, clean out void and install LUXE Linear Drain channel as you
would any tile building up and supporting as necessary with mortar. Ensure
drain channel is level and just slightly below (1/16” or less) adjacent tile.

- LUXE Linear Drain outlet sets uncoupled into the drain body providing a path for
moisture to pass from the tile bed down and out the drain which will preserve the
quality and longevity of your tile installation. (This serves the same purpose as
the weep holes in the drain body.)
